Precise and valid measurement results are an important basis for the optimal medical care of patients. Point of Care Testing (POCT) allows the required measured values to be determined directly and immediately on the patient and transferred promptly to the hospital and laboratory information systems. Microfluidics is a decisive factor in the realization of such systems, as it is the only way to achieve the required miniaturization of the test instruments. Additionally, automation solutions in the production of POCT devices can not only save valuable resources in the form of hands-on time, but also valuable sample material and expensive reaction materials.
